Question 1: What is the primary purpose of a dollar bill origami coin box?
Answer: A dollar bill origami coin box serves as a compact and functional container, primarily designed to store and organize coins securely. It offers a practical and aesthetically pleasing alternative to traditional coin purses or bulky wallets.
Question 2: Is creating a dollar bill origami coin box challenging?
Answer: The level of difficulty may vary depending on the chosen design and one’s experience with origami. However, with clear instructions and a bit of practice, most individuals can successfully create a functional and visually appealing dollar bill origami coin box.
Question 3: Does making a dollar bill origami coin box require special tools or materials?
Answer: Typically, no special tools or materials are needed. All that is required is a single dollar bill, although some variations may incorporate additional decorative elements like colored paper or stickers.
Question 4: How durable is a dollar bill origami coin box?
Answer: The durability of a dollar bill origami coin box depends on the quality of the bill and the skill of the folder. With proper folding techniques and handling, a dollar bill origami coin box can be quite durable and withstand regular use.
Question 5: Can dollar bill origami coin boxes be used for other purposes besides storing coins?
Answer: While primarily intended for coin storage, dollar bill origami coin boxes can also be repurposed for various uses, such as storing small jewelry items, paper clips, or even folded notes.
Question 6: Is the skill of making dollar bill origami coin boxes easily transferable to other origami projects?
Answer: The basic folding techniques used in dollar bill origami coin boxes provide a foundation for exploring more intricate origami projects. With practice and exploration, individuals can expand their origami skills to create various shapes and objects.

Tips for Creating Unique Dollar Bill Origami Coin Boxes
This section provides practical tips and techniques to help you create visually appealing and functional dollar bill origami coin boxes. Follow these steps to enhance your origami skills and produce unique coin boxes that are both aesthetically pleasing and practical.
Tip 1: Choose the Right Dollar Bill
Selecting a crisp and undamaged dollar bill is essential for creating a sturdy and attractive coin box. Avoid using worn or torn bills, as they may tear during the folding process.
Tip 2: Master the Basic Folds
Familiarize yourself with the fundamental origami folds, such as the square fold, triangle fold, and mountain fold. These basic folds serve as the building blocks for more complex origami projects, including the dollar bill coin box.
Tip 3: Follow Clear Instructions
When attempting a new origami project, it’s crucial to follow clear and detailed instructions. Numerous online tutorials and books provide step-by-step guides to help you create your dollar bill coin box.
Tip 4: Be Patient and Persistent
Origami requires patience and persistence. Don’t get discouraged if you don’t get it right the first time. Keep practicing, and with time, you’ll be able to create intricate and beautiful origami coin boxes.
